To be responsible for providing responsive, high quality, professional and timely executive support to the Mayor and for ensuring the Executive Support Team operates efficiently and effectively in a highly pressured environment.

To provide a responsive, high quality, professional and timely support to the Chief Executive/Corporate Directors and associated governance including responsibility for all aspects of the smooth running of meetings, from effective forward planning to attending in person to take minutes. To work collaboratively with the Head of Mayor’s Office to ensure that the services provided by the team are strategically aligned with other functional areas to enable a seamless approach to service delivery and to continually improve policies, procedures and processes that meet business needs.

To maximise the use of technology to improve processes and workflow, through the identification of improvement and efficiencies, the deployment of new functionality and system enhancements to improve value for money and service provision to internal users.

To utilise performance systems and analytics tools to monitor and support delivery on behalf of the Mayor. To liaise with residents and stakeholders on behalf of the Mayor. To manage meetings with potential developers, working with planning officers to ensure proper process is followed at all times. To act on behalf of the Head of Mayor’s Office in their absence. To work in the office five days a week.
